The titans of finance occupy this densely developed neighborhood of modern glass skyscrapers and stately stone buildings. Just steps away, you can tour Federal Hall, where George Washington took the oath of office. The iconic Charging Bull statue is a few blocks farther, at Bowling Green. Take a 10-minute walk to Battery Park, where you can board a ferry to the Statue of Liberty and Ellis Island. Or witness the rebirth of the World Trade Center Site, one-third mile from the Club Quarters, Wall Street. Subway stops around the neighborhood, including one just outside the hotel, connect to Times Square, Midtown offices, and beyond.
Full of Old New York charm, this Club Quarters' ornate stone-and-brick building opened as a bank in 1895.
